About

Little Coon Creek Park is a U.S. Army Corps of Engineers campground situated on Gillham Lake in the rugged Ouachita Mountains of southwestern Arkansas. The park features 10 campsites, each equipped with water and 50-amp electric hookups, making it suitable for RVs and trailers. Modern amenities include hot showers, flush restrooms, and a nearby dump station. The campground also offers a group picnic shelter, playground, and a boat ramp with a handicap accessible fishing pier. Gillham Lake spans 1,370 surface acres with 36 miles of shoreline along the Cossatot River, which is designated as a National Wild and Scenic River. The lake is known for its excellent fishing, with anglers targeting smallmouth, largemouth, and spotted bass, saugeye, crappie, channel and flathead catfish, and various sunfish species. Fly fishing is particularly popular. Boaters will appreciate the easy water access via the boat ramp, and hunters can pursue game north of Little Coon Creek Park and on the lake's eastern shore. The rugged terrain creates stunning views and provides a peaceful setting for camping. Campers must register with the Big Coon Creek Park Attendant before staying. Nearby attractions include Cossatot River State Park-Natural Area and Queen Wilhelmina State Park, both offering hiking, scenery, and interpretive programs. The campground operates first-come, first-served with a maximum of 2 tents and 8 occupants per site.

Directions

From US-59/71 at Grannis, Arkansas, turn east onto County Rd 3/Frachiseur Rd and stay on this road for 5 miles and then follow the signs into the park.
